Matterhorn Peak
The concepts of the Alps and Switzerland are practically inseparable. After all, this mountain range occupies more than half of the country's area. The Swiss Alps are divided into three parts. The Jura massif is located in the northwestern part of the country.
From the south it is bordered by the Pennine Alps. And in the center is an extensive Swiss plateau. Mount Matterhorn is in the TOP 10 of not only the most beautiful places in Switzerland, but also in Italy. After all, a state border has been laid along it. In Italy, this mountain has a different name - Cervinha.
Matterhorn immediately catches the eye, and asks for the camera lens. This peak has an almost regular pyramid shape and rises far from other mountains. The Swiss consider Matterhorn to be the symbol of their country. No wonder they placed his image on a 50-franc gold coin.
The outlines of the Matterhorn can also be seen on the wrapper of the famous Swiss Tobleron chocolate. In order to conquer this impregnable peak with a height of 4478 meters, you need to be a professional climber. But ordinary tourists can get closer to the Matterhorn nevertheless.
To do this, climb to the top of the neighboring mountains - Gornergrat. Is it hard to stomp on your own two? Tourists say that to a height of more than 3 thousand meters, that is, the top of the mountain, you can deliver a special panoramic funicular train.
At the foot of the Matterhorn there are ski resorts: Zermatt on the Swiss side and Bray Cervinha on the Italian side. Skating, thanks to the glacier, is possible even in summer.
Mount Pilatus
If we talk about the best places in Switzerland in winter, then this peak can argue with the Matterhorn. Pilatus is located in the center of the country, southeast of Lucerne. The name of the mountain of legend is associated with the famous Roman procurator of Judea.
After Pontius Pilate put Christ to death, he repented and committed suicide. But the waters of the Tiber uprooted the body of the suicide. Two attempts to drown a corpse in the Rhone and Lake Geneva were also unsuccessful. Then the body of Pontius Pilate was thrown into the pond from the top of the mountain, which received his name. Local legends assure that the inconsolable soul of the procurator still roams the slopes, which is why villages , landslides and landslides are constantly falling on nearby villages .
But all this is nothing more than a beautiful legend. Anyone can climb to the top of Pilatus, because the height of the mountain is only 2128 meters. Tourists recommend starting a hiking ascent from Alpnahstadt. From there, the coolest train in the world departs. He is able to overcome the rise of 48 degrees!
And from the village of Kriens to the top of Pilatus there is a cable car. But not only for the sake of a panoramic view, tourists come up here. In winter, the Snow & Fan amusement park operates here.
Lake Geneva
Not only the mountains are the most beautiful places in Switzerland. God has gifted this country with more than one and a half thousand lakes. The largest of them (and the second largest in Europe) is Lehman. So the Swiss and French call Lake Geneva.
And poetic natures refer to him only as the “Mirror of the Alps”. After all, the mountains approach the pond in a dense ring, extinguishing even the smallest wind, so that the expanse of the lake is always calm and serene. This mirror reflects the old houses of Geneva, medieval castles on the cliffs and vineyards on the slopes.
On the lake, extending a crescent moon in the floodplain of the Rhone, passes the border between Switzerland and France. The entire northern coast, owned by the first country, is studded with resorts. As mountains approach the lake from the north, reliably protecting it from cold winds, the climate here is Mediterranean. Therefore, the chain of resort towns is called the Swiss or Geneva Riviera.
Only here you can sunbathe on a sun lounger and enjoy the snow-capped peaks of the Alps. But tourists in the reviews warn: you can swim comfortably only in July-August. Deep Lehman warms up slowly.
Rhine Falls
In Switzerland, not only the famous French river Rhone originates . In the local Alps, the mighty Rhine also appears on the surface, with which many legends are associated in Germany (about the Nibelungs, about Lorelei).
The height of the waterfall is not the most impressive - 23 meters (approximately like a 7-storey building), but it is one of the most beautiful places in Switzerland. In summer, at the time of melting mountain glaciers, this natural attraction is preferable to visit. After all, then about 700 cubic meters of water collapses from the cliff every second.
You can get to the Rhine Falls from Zurich by bus or train. You need to drive your car through Schaffhausen, Bulach or Winterthur. You can admire the waterfall from two observation platforms. The first is on a ledge that hangs over the abyss.
A wall of water collapses very close, and it seems that it is about to pick you up and carry away with you. To the second observation deck you need to sail in a boat. It is located on a tiny island in the middle of the river. From here, the waterfall is visible from above. The view is simply unreal and conquers the heart with its pristine beauty.
Caves of St. Beatus
The most motley crowd is going to Switzerland. It is interesting for both lovers of natural beauty and history lovers, because the region has been inhabited since the Neolithic, many monuments of the ancient Roman era and the Middle Ages have been preserved here. Here, mountain skiers, climbers, trekkers and even divers will also like it.
There are interesting places in Switzerland and for children. One of them is the cave of St. Beatus. They are located on the shores of Lake Thun, near the town of Interlaken, in the canton of Bern. For adult visitors, caves tell the legend of the young Suetonius, whom his parents sent to study in Rome.
Having met St. Peter on the way, he turned to God, tonsured monks and, adopting the Christian name Beatus, settled in a monastery, which he himself built on an impregnable rock. For young visitors, the story is colored with fabulous details. Allegedly, in order to build a monastery, Suetonius-Beatus first had to fight the fire-breathing dragon, which terrorized the entire district.
In the caves, everything recalls the presence of a monster. Stalactites and stalagmites look like a toothy mouth. At the entrance is a sculpture of a fire-breathing monster, and on the underground lake you can ride a boat in the form of a dragon.
Aletsch Glacier
Tourists recommend a ride on the Jungfrau Ban Railway. Its last kilometers pass in the tunnel, and when the train emerges to the surface of the earth, the hearts of the passengers freeze with admiration.
The glimpse of the Aletsch Glacier is one of the most beautiful places in Switzerland. Photos of this attraction are decorated with all country guides. It is the largest glacier in the Alps. It consists of three glaciers who, converging together, turn into a frozen river.
It moves at a speed of 200 meters per year. If you listen, you can catch the rustling and crackling of an ice tongue sliding down.
Verzaska River
This interesting place in Switzerland attracts not only lovers of natural beauty and history, but also divers. The waters of the Verzaska River are not just clean - they are sterile. And for some reason there is no life in them, even the simplest organisms and algae. Tourists advise getting here from Locarno.
The river is born on a glacier at an altitude of 2864 meters and after 30 km flows into Lake Maggiore. The water in it is amazing turquoise, and sometimes dark blue or malachite. The depth of Verzaska sometimes reaches 15 meters. But because of the absolute purity, every pebble is visible at the bottom. Divers in thermal suits go down to the depth to photograph not the underwater inhabitants, but the panorama above. Shores and passing clouds are visible through the water column.
And extreme people can repeat the James Bond feat from the Golden Eye series, which rushed down from the tall dam. Now it has a bungee jumping platform.
We explore the country by car
The most beautiful places in Switzerland can be seen all at once, if you travel in your own or rented car. Tourists recommend visiting the oldest and largest in the country of the two available - National Natural Park. It is located around the town of Zernets, in the Engadine Valley, in the canton of Graubünden.
It's hard to believe, but a century ago, these places were a depressing sight. Forests were mercilessly cut down, and in the mountains there were mines and quarries. But the good political will of the Swiss helped restore its pristine appearance to nature.
It should be remembered that in the reserve you can not go off the hiking trails and even shout loudly. Here, not a man feels a full owner, but wild animals and birds.
Lauterbrunnen
The most beautiful places in Switzerland are connected with mountain nature. Pearl streams, crystal waterfalls, emerald moss, multi-colored alpine meadows - all this can be seen in the Lauterbrunnen valley. It is small - only a kilometer wide and eight in length.
But it is a deep canyon, sandwiched by high cliffs. And in this small area 72 waterfalls fall out, and the high mountains of Jungfrau, Aiger and Mench serve as the background to this postcard view.
Canton of Ticino
To see the most beautiful places in Switzerland in winter, you need to go to the high Alps - to the ski resorts of Zermatt and St. Moritz. But if you arrived in the country in the summer, do not miss the trip to the Italian-speaking canton of Ticino.
The capital - Bellinzona - will surprise you with medieval sights. The canton of Ticino is close to Italy not only in the local dialect.
The climate here is also Mediterranean. Oleanders and cypresses will create the illusion of relaxation in the southern country.
